Developers in Gujarat expect property prices to rise by Rs 400-500 per square foot due to significant increases in raw material costs, including steel and cement.

Housing demand in tier-II and tier-III cities plummeted by 35% in the first half of the fiscal year, primarily due to increased borrowing costs, as per Assocham's assessment.
